Product Overview

The ROSS Controls Mid-Size Series is a modular Filter Regulator Lubricator (FRL) combination product line designed for 1/4" to 1/2" port size compressed air systems. The Mid-Size Series delivers combined filtration, pressure regulation, and lubrication with flow capacity up to 100 scfm (2832 l/min), addressing the air preparation requirements of the majority of industrial pneumatic systems and machine-mounted air treatment applications.

The modular mounting design of the Mid-Size Series allows individual filter, regulator, and lubricator units to be interconnected side-by-side on a common manifold bracket, forming a compact inline FRL station that can be assembled to meet the exact air treatment stages required by the application. Each component can also be installed as a standalone unit where only a single air preparation function is needed.

The filter component is available with a polycarbonate plastic bowl with shatterguard protection or a zinc metal bowl, accommodating different environmental conditions. Internal automatic drain and manual drain options are available to match condensate volume and maintenance preferences. The piston-type regulator provides stable output pressure regulation with self-relieving or non-relieving function. A sight-feed lubricator delivers visible, adjustable oil delivery into the air stream, allowing the operator to confirm and control lubrication rate during operation.

The integral pressure gauge on the regulator unit provides continuous output pressure monitoring at the air preparation station. The Mid-Size Series is the standard selection for main machine air preparation in 1/4" through 1/2" pneumatic systems across general industrial, automotive, packaging, and food and beverage manufacturing applications.

Key Engineering Features

  • Modular FRL Combination System - Individual filter, regulator, and lubricator units interconnect on a common bracket to form a compact modular FRL station, allowing users to assemble only the air treatment stages required without excess components.
  • High Flow Capacity for Mid-Size Port Range - Delivers up to 100 scfm (2832 l/min), providing adequate flow capacity for the majority of 1/4" to 1/2" port size pneumatic circuits in machine and process automation applications.
  • Modular Mounting Design - Components mount side-by-side on standard modular brackets for organized, space-efficient installation that simplifies maintenance access to each component independently.
  • Polycarbonate Bowl with Shatterguard or Zinc Bowl - Polycarbonate bowl with zinc shatterguard combines visual condensate level monitoring with mechanical bowl protection; zinc metal bowl provides a fully sealed metal enclosure for harsh environments.
  • Internal Automatic or Manual Drain Filter - Internal automatic drain continuously expels accumulated condensate; manual drain provides operator-controlled drainage during maintenance intervals for lower condensate volume applications.
  • Piston-Type Regulator - Piston-type pressure regulator provides stable regulated output pressure with consistent performance across the flow demand range of 1/4" to 1/2" pneumatic systems.
  • Self-Relieving or Non-Relieving Regulator - Self-relieving function vents downstream pressure to atmosphere when set point is reduced; non-relieving option retains downstream pressure for restricted-vent circuits.
  • Sight-Feed Lubricator - Sight-feed design provides visible confirmation of oil delivery rate through a window or sight tube, allowing operators to observe and adjust the lubrication rate during system operation.
  • Integral Pressure Gauge - Pressure gauge is included as standard on regulator units for continuous monitoring of regulated output pressure at the FRL station.

Q: What is modular mounting?

A: Modular mounting allows individual filter, regulator, and lubricator units to be connected side-by-side using manifold connection hardware and a common support bracket. The modular assembly can then be mounted as a single unit on a wall, panel, or pipe support, forming a compact FRL station.

Q: What is the difference between the polycarbonate bowl with shatterguard and the zinc bowl?

A: The polycarbonate bowl with shatterguard provides visual monitoring of condensate level while the zinc shatterguard protects the bowl from impact damage. The zinc metal bowl offers a fully opaque metal enclosure for environments with greater mechanical hazard, higher ambient temperatures (up to 150 degrees F), or higher operating pressures (up to 200 psig).

Q: What is a sight-feed lubricator?

A: A sight-feed lubricator has a visible window or drop sight tube that allows the operator to observe oil dripping into the air stream during operation. This provides direct visual confirmation that lubrication is occurring and allows the delivery rate to be monitored and adjusted. The sight-feed design is particularly useful during commissioning and maintenance to verify proper lubricator function.

Q: Can the Mid-Size Series be used without the lubricator?

A: Yes. The modular design allows the FRL to be assembled as a filter-only, filter/regulator, or filter/regulator/lubricator combination. Omit the lubricator when downstream components use pre-lubricated or non-lubricated seals, or when instrument air quality requirements prohibit oil in the compressed air stream.

Q: What drain option should I select?

A: Select the internal automatic drain for applications with high condensate volume, high humidity environments, or where continuous unattended operation is required. Select the manual drain for lower condensate volume applications where the operator performs scheduled draining during maintenance intervals.

Q: How should the FRL combination be oriented during installation?

A: Mount with the bowls in the downward (vertical) position to allow condensate to collect at the bowl drain for proper expulsion. The FRL station should be positioned to allow access to the drain valves and lubricator fill port during routine maintenance.

Q: How do I set the lubrication rate on the sight-feed lubricator?

A: Adjust the lubrication rate needle valve on the lubricator while observing the sight glass or drop sight tube. The standard starting rate is approximately one drop of oil per minute per pneumatic actuator or tool downstream. Adjust the rate based on actual lubricant consumption and downstream component requirements.

Installation & Maintenance Guidelines

  • Mount the Mid-Size Series FRL assembly with the bowls in the downward (vertical) position to ensure condensate collects at the bowl drain for proper expulsion.
  • Install the units in the correct sequence: filter (inlet) - regulator (middle) - lubricator (outlet). Filtered air must enter the regulator and lubricated air must exit last to protect the regulator diaphragm or piston from contaminated air and prevent oil from flooding upstream components.
  • Verify that the flow direction arrow on each unit body is aligned with the compressed air flow direction before making port connections.
  • Apply appropriate thread sealant to all NPT port connections. Tighten connections to the torque specified in the ROSS Controls installation instructions for the Mid-Size Series.
  • After making all plumbing connections, pressurize the system gradually and inspect all connections, bowl seals, and port threads for air leakage using an approved leak detection solution.
  • Set regulated output pressure by pulling or turning the regulator adjustment knob to unlock it, rotating clockwise to increase pressure or counterclockwise to decrease, observing the gauge, and locking at the set point.
  • Fill the lubricator bowl with recommended petroleum-based oil (ISO viscosity grade 32 or lighter) to the maximum fill level indicated on the bowl. Do not overfill.
  • Adjust the lubricator oil delivery rate using the needle valve on the lubricator while observing the sight glass. A starting rate of approximately one drop per minute per downstream actuator is typical.
  • For modular assemblies, verify that all modular connection hardware is properly tightened and sealed between adjacent units to prevent internal air leakage at module interfaces.
  • For automatic drain models, confirm that the drain operates correctly after installation by observing condensate discharge during normal system operation.
  • Inspect and drain manual drain units on a scheduled basis appropriate to the condensate volume in the system. Never allow condensate to overflow into the compressed air outlet.
  • Replace filter elements when differential pressure across the filter reaches the service threshold, or at the scheduled maintenance interval. Always shut off inlet pressure before removing the bowl for element replacement.
